Why These Are the Top Home Security Contractors in Buffalo

** The home security market in Buffalo, Texas, is characteristic of a smaller, rural city. There are no major home security companies with a physical storefront located directly within the Buffalo city limits. Consequently, the market is served primarily by large national providers like ADT, Vivint, and Guardian Protection, which dispatch certified technicians from regional hubs to perform installations and repairs. **Competition Level:** Moderate, but not saturated with local competitors. The competition is between a handful of well-established national firms. **Average Quality:** High. Residents have access to the same technology, professional monitoring centers, and service quality as major metropolitan areas due to the reach of these national providers.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ive with national averages. Expect initial equipment and installation costs to range from $0 to $500 (often with a contract), with monthly monitoring fees typically falling between **$40 and $70** depending on the level of service, smart home features, and video storage requirements.

1What is the typical cost for a professionally installed home security system in Buffalo, TX, and are there any local factors that affect pricing?

In the Buffalo area, a basic professionally installed system typically starts between $200-$600 for equipment and installation, with monthly monitoring fees ranging from $30 to $60. Local factors that can influence cost include the larger property sizes common in rural Leon County, which may require more sensors or longer-range equipment, and the need for cellular backup (highly recommended) due to potential reliance on less robust landline infrastructure in some areas.

2How does the Texas climate, with its heat, humidity, and severe weather, impact the choice and maintenance of a home security system in Buffalo?

The intense Texas heat and humidity can degrade exterior camera housings and sensors over time, so choosing equipment with a high weather-resistance (IP65 rating or higher) is crucial. Furthermore, given the region's susceptibility to severe thunderstorms and occasional tornadoes, a system with a reliable cellular and battery backup is essential to ensure protection remains active during frequent power outages.

5With Buffalo being a more rural community, what are the most effective security measures for protecting outbuildings, livestock, or large properties?

For comprehensive protection of rural properties, integrate perimeter security solutions like wireless motion-activated cameras and solar-powered motion-sensor lights for barns and gates. Consider a security system that offers cellular trail cameras or gate sensors as add-ons, and ensure your monitoring plan includes specific protocols for property intrusions, as emergency response times can be longer in rural areas.
